Lines Matching refs:bank
110 uintptr_t stm32_get_gpio_bank_base(unsigned int bank) in stm32_get_gpio_bank_base() argument
112 if (bank == GPIO_BANK_Z) { in stm32_get_gpio_bank_base()
116 assert(bank <= GPIO_BANK_K); in stm32_get_gpio_bank_base()
118 return GPIOA_BASE + (bank * GPIO_BANK_OFFSET); in stm32_get_gpio_bank_base()
121 uint32_t stm32_get_gpio_bank_offset(unsigned int bank) in stm32_get_gpio_bank_offset() argument
123 if (bank == GPIO_BANK_Z) { in stm32_get_gpio_bank_offset()
127 assert(bank <= GPIO_BANK_K); in stm32_get_gpio_bank_offset()
129 return bank * GPIO_BANK_OFFSET; in stm32_get_gpio_bank_offset()
132 unsigned long stm32_get_gpio_bank_clock(unsigned int bank) in stm32_get_gpio_bank_clock() argument
134 if (bank == GPIO_BANK_Z) { in stm32_get_gpio_bank_clock()
138 assert(bank <= GPIO_BANK_K); in stm32_get_gpio_bank_clock()
140 return CK_BUS_GPIOA + (bank - GPIO_BANK_A); in stm32_get_gpio_bank_clock()